[QUOTE="BMP, post: 2695925, member: 32433"] They are most definitely worth every penny. I have a Surefire SOCOM 300 SPS and 6.5 Ti. I have used the 300 SPS on a 10.5" 300 BLK SBR, 24" 6.5CM and 18" CM. It has been ran hard and is built like a tank. The 6.5Ti is VERY light @ 11 ounces and is not noticeable on any gun. It is slightly quieter on the 6.5 stuff vs. the SPS. POI shift is minimal on every application with both of these. Buy once cry once the cost is well worth the results. It's not only just for the shooter, save your hunting/shooting buddies hearing and enjoy it for what it is. Everyone that hears my guns with the cans off and on find them extremely efficient. There is absolutely no comparison between the two. Brad [/QUOTE]
